digtools
✍️
image text overlay,

Image Text Overlay Tool

Add text to images with custom fonts, sizes, colors & shadows.Drag to position. Save as PNG or JPEG. 100% browser-based.

🔤
Free Google Fonts
Google Fonts
👆
Drag to
Place text
🔒
No server upload
Your image is never sent to a server
🔒 Your image is never sent to a server. All processing happens in your browser.
🖼️

Select image

JPEG · PNG · WebP · GIF · BMP

about,

About

A free browser-based tool to overlay text on images with full customization. Supports Google Fonts including Japanese and Western typefaces, with controls for size, color, shadow, rotation, and opacity.

Perfect for social media graphics, YouTube thumbnails, banners, and announcements. Stack multiple text layers and drag them into position intuitively.

Your image is never sent to any server, ensuring complete privacy.

how to use,

How to Use

STEP 1

Select image

Open the image you want to edit using the file selector button.

STEP 2

Add text

Enter text and configure font, size, color, and shadow. Drag to position freely.

STEP 3

Save image

Select PNG or JPEG and click Save. Your finished image is saved instantly.

glossary,

Glossary

Canvas API
An HTML5 standard API for pixel-level drawing in the browser, used for text compositing.
Google Fonts
A free web font service by Google offering a wide range of Japanese and Western typefaces.
Text Overlay
A technique of layering text on top of an image, widely used for thumbnails and banners.
Font Size (px)
A value specifying text size in pixels.
Text Shadow
An effect that adds a shadow to text, improving legibility against various backgrounds.
Opacity
The transparency level of text. 0% is fully transparent; 100% is fully opaque.
Layer
An independent text element that can be moved, resized, and styled separately.
Thumbnail
A small preview image shown in video or blog listings.
PNG format
A lossless, transparency-supporting image format ideal for high-quality output.
JPEG format
A lossy compressed format for photos that reduces file size.
faq,

FAQ

Q.What image formats are supported?
All formats a browser can display: JPEG, PNG, WebP, GIF, BMP, SVG, and more.
Q.How many text layers can I add?
Unlimited. Add, select, and delete layers freely.
Q.Are Japanese fonts available?
Yes. Google Fonts including Noto Sans JP and Noto Serif JP are supported.
Q.Is my image sent to a server?
Never. All processing happens entirely in your browser.
Q.Does it work on mobile?
Yes. The interface is responsive and supports touch drag.
Q.Is the output the same resolution as the original?
Yes. The canvas preserves the original image resolution internally.
Q.Can I fine-tune text position?
Yes. Drag to move freely with pixel-level precision.
Q.Should I use PNG or JPEG?
PNG if you need transparency; JPEG if you want a smaller file size.
Q.Are bold and italic supported?
Yes. Toggle Bold and Italic using the checkboxes.
Q.Can I add a shadow to the text?
Yes. Enable shadow and adjust color and blur with the controls.
use cases,

Use Cases

📱 Social Media Graphics

Add captions, hashtags, or quotes to Instagram, X, and Facebook posts.

🎬 YouTube Thumbnails

Overlay eye-catching title text on your video thumbnails.

📢 Event Announcements

Create promotional banners with text overlaid on background images.

📝 Blog Headers

Combine your article title with a header image for a polished look.

Disclaimer

The tools provided on this site are completely free to use, but please use them at your own risk. We make no guarantees regarding the accuracy, completeness, or safety of any calculation results, conversion results, or generated data. Please be aware that the operator assumes no responsibility for any damages or troubles caused by the use of these tools. Most tools process files and calculations locally in your browser, meaning your inputted data is neither sent to nor stored on our servers.